Summarizes how a single drop of blood around the pulmonary and systemic circuits passes through the four chambers of the heart (the right atrium, the right ventricle, the left atrium, and the left ventricle) and is delivered throughout the body tissues. It is important to understand that both atria contract at the same time and both ventricles contract at the same time. Therefore, the heart works as two pumps, with the right and the left side working in a synchronized manner.
